For 15 years, ALT CITIZEN, the independent music publication, live show promoter, and zine, has been a pioneer in uplifting, inspiring, and keeping alive New York City underground music, its community, and story.
Established in 2010, ALT CITIZEN’s roots stem from those of music journalism’s heyday – music discovery through tangible media, on-the-ground live show reports, authentic taste-making, au fait curation of bills, show roundups, and new music lists, amongst more – and continues to maintain its status as a clocker of legends and respected platform that understands music, shares good music, and supports the passion of musicians that we too are fueled by every day.
